What Is a Manual Thumb and How Does It Work?

A manual thumb:  sometimes referred to as a mechanical thumb, static thumb, or digger grab — is an attachment that mounts to the dipper arm of your excavator. Once fitted, the thumb works like the upper jaw of a grab bucket excavator, the bucket is then manipulated towards the manual thumb to grip and hold material securely while you lift, move, or place it.

Unlike a hydraulic clamp or hydraulic thumb, a manual thumb is positioned and locked by hand into one of three fixed positions. This makes it a straightforward, cost-effective alternative for operators who need reliable grabbing capability but don't require continuous thumb movement during operation. For many applications — clearing scrub, handling rocks, shifting logs, or cleaning up demolition waste — a manual thumb performs just as effectively as a more complex hydraulic system, at a fraction of the cost.

Easy to Install Mechanical Thumb:  Retrofits to New and Used Excavators

One of the key advantages of the KNAPP excavator thumb design is how simple it is to install. Each thumb comes equipped with a weld-on backing plate that attaches directly to the dipper arm of your excavator. This means it can be retrofitted to both new and existing machines without major modification, making it a practical upgrade for operators looking to get more out of their current equipment.

Once the backing plate is welded in place, the thumb can be positioned using the strong arm into one of three fixed positions to suit the material being handled and the task at hand. This adjustability gives you meaningful control over grip depth and angle, even without a hydraulic system driving the movement.

Manual Thumb vs Hydraulic Thumb - Which Do You Need?

If your work requires constant, on-the-fly adjustment of the thumb position while operating, for example sorting material or working in tight spaces, a hydraulic clamp or thumb may be the better option. KNAPP also manufactures hydraulic thumbs with a short lead time for all excavator sizes.

However, if your applications are more straightforward and you primarily need a reliable digger grab for moving bulk material, a manual mechanical thumb is a proven, cost-effective choice that requires less maintenance and no additional hydraulic circuitry.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a manual thumb and how is it different from a hydraulic clamp? A manual thumb is a static or mechanical thumb that is positioned by hand into fixed positions along the dipper arm. A hydraulic clamp or hydraulic thumb is controlled via the excavator's hydraulic system, allowing continuous movement during operation. A manual thumb is simpler, lower cost, and requires less maintenance, making it ideal for most standard grabbing tasks.

What do people mean when they say "digger grab"? Digger grab is a common NZ term for any attachment that allows an excavator to grip and hold material effectively turning the machine into a grab bucket excavator. A manual or hydraulic thumb can be used with all of your existing buckets effectively creating a range of grab buckets for your excavator.
